We try to stick to British English.
- Use unabigous language.
- Be enjoyable to read.
- Vvoid personal speech.
- A confused reader is bad documentation.
- Don't take readers for fools.
- Strive to be as accessible as possible while retaining expressiveness.
- Start with a quick abstract what the page is going to teach.
- Use tips, notes, warnings, and dangers as required. They catch readers attention.
- Document all quirks and name them as such.
